> I would like to know about the status of ApacheDS and OSGi. I saw
that there is a dedicated branch on SVN and I read that some parts of
the server are now OSGi compliant.
Yes, we are working heavily on moving ApacheDS to OSGI. However it is
not fully functional in any container for now.
>
> Does the server already run in a container, eg. Karaf? If so, how
does it work? How can I deploy it?
>
It can work on Karaf, but still need lots of work. We don't just want
it to work on OSGI, we also want it to be fully extendible. So, we're
changing the codebase to make it fit on OSGI model both as logic and
code. Once we're done, you will see the custom karaf container as a
part of the ApacheDS build.
So once you're done, starting ApacheDS means starting Karaf with
ApacheDS running inside? This would be great because then ApacheDS can
be run in any Karaf container in any other project.
By 'custom karaf container' you mean that you are going to extend the
karaf shell commands? Or are there other things you want to customize /
extend?
